AMMAN - The Ministry of Water and Irrigation, on Friday, warned of the unstable weather conditions that will take place tonight until next Sunday.
According to the Jordan Meteorological Department (JMD), the ministry said in a statement, the Kingdom is expected to witness unstable weather conditions, bringing heavy rain and causing flash floods in low-lying areas.
The ministry called on the public to ensure that rainwater gutters are not connected to sewage networks and report any complaints and violations to the unified number: 117116.
